Description Guide:

With wonderful views over the upper Clun Valley is this detached dormer Bungalow, standing in gardens and grounds of approx. 4/10th of an acre. The property, which has recently been extended and improved has accommodation of Living Room, separate Sitting Room, fitted Kitchen, Bedroom and Bathroom. On the first floor is a further Bedroom and Bathroom. Useful outbuilding comprising Garage, small Barn and Woodstore.
(EPC rating D)

Ael Y Bryn is a detached dormer bungalow standing in gardens and grounds of approx 4/10th of an acre with views over the upper Clun Valley. Newcastle is a pretty village having Primary School, Community Centre, Church and Public House. The village of Clun is around 4 miles away with a range of Shops, Pub, Restaurants and Doctors Surgery.

Entrance Door to Reception Hall with tiled flooring, radiator, centre light, central heating thermostat, power points. Door leads to

Living Room with feature fireplace, pine flooring, radiator, power points and centre light. Secondary glazed window to the side. French doors to verandah with these wonderful views.

Bedroom 2 with centre light and radiator. Fireplace, pine flooring. Secondary glazed window to the side overlooking the garden and French doors to verandah again with wonderful views.

Sitting Room / Dining Room with centre light and power points. Quarry tiled flooring. Fireplace inset with wood burner on a tiled hearth. Double glazed French doors to side, secondary glazed window to the rear. Door leads to
Kitchen is fitted with matching wall and floor units, heat resistant work surfaces, sink unit, h&c, space for cooker (lpg) radiator and centre light. 2 windows looking onto the garden. An alcove housing a Worcester Green Style Heatslave 1825 boiler with shelving over. Door leads from the Kitchen to outside.

From the Hallway a door leads through to a Study with radiator, fireplace, wall lights and power points. Secondary glazed window to the side. Door leads to a

Bathroom with panelled bath, hand basin and W.C. Radiator. Tiling to dado and tiled floor. Centre light and obscured window to the side.

Staircase leads from the Study area to First Floor Landing where there is eaves storage space.

2nd Bathroom with bath with shower attachment, hand basin and W.C. Radiator, centre light and extractor fan.
Velux up and over window

Bedroom 1 with centre light, radiator and power points. Double glazed window to the front with these amazing views over the surrounding countryside. Alcove with rails.

Garage with double opening doors and window to side. 5.82m x 3.69m. There is an adjoining Store Room / Workshop which is 4.30m x 3.80m. Adjacent to this there is a corrugated Log Store.

Outside The property is approached by way of a tarmacadam drive leading to a parking and turning area.

The property has a large garden which slopes up behind the bungalow to some woodland. Within the garden is a productive vegetable sectin and a number of fruit trees.

Directions Into Newcastle turn right just past the Crown Inn, continue to the end of that lane where you will get to a T junction. Turn right and Ael-y-bryn will be seen about 200 yards along that lane on the left hand side.
